About Alpena

Alpena is a tiny community in northwestern Arkansas, home to 390 residents as of the latest Census estimates.

Officially, Alpena is an incorporated town — local government on a neighborly scale. The community covers 1.33 square miles, giving it wide-open spaces and a spread-out, rural feel at roughly 293 residents per square mile.
